The book is a topical commentary and Bible reference based on the Scriptures from the Old and New Testaments. After the introduction, the first section explains the Messiah's purpose and focuses on the foundations for salvation through the Messiah. The second section focuses on emotional topics and how they affect your relationship with the Messiah. The root of many emotional issues is caused by bitterness, so the causes of bitterness and forgiveness are explained in simple terms easily understood by the reader and how they affect salvation. Next the reader explores love, compassion mercy, pride and humility and how they affect their relationship with God. Digging deeper into the emotional issues the reader learns God's definition for lust and purity of heart. The next section deals with the intangible issues in the reader's life. This includes faith, sanctification, repentance and the importance of total surrender to God. The holy Spirit is explained in detail with an emphasis on His purpose for you. Section four covers some of the symbolism in the Bible and tries to help the reader see things from the cultural view of Jesus time. The desire is to help the reader understand how symbolism points to salvation and the importance of events symbolically. Section five covers almost all the parables of Jesus found in the Gospels. The parables are grouped into broad categories including: "The Kingdom of God," "Service and Obedience," "Prayer," "Humility," "God's Love," "Jesus Return," and "God's Values." The parables are explained in detail using the cultural setting of Jesus time. Section six is a brief overview of biblical history and Israel's history. The next section begins with a discussion about the rapture at Christ's second coming. The various points of view are discussed. Then the anti-Christ and False Prophet are explained. Revelation is covered extensively, but not by analyzing the symbolism. The first article is "Don't fear the book of Revelation," followed by "Revelation: The real Message," These articles explain the purpose and message for Revelation and try to remove the fear factor that most people feel. The final section is designed to challenge your thinking and bring you closer to God.
